A short webinar looking at sometimes worrying issue of internet safety, which even for children without any cognitive or processing difficulties can present problems and be a cause of concern for parents
This session is delivered by Lucy Perkins, Child & Family Support Coordinator at the Child Brain Injury Trust.
On completion of the Webinar participants will further their understanding of:
- Why children with an ABI may be more vulnerable and susceptible to the dangers posed by some internet activities
- What the safety issues are and how children and young people can be misguided
- How to protect your child/children from these issues
